What Does Whoops Mean?

The term whoops is an exclamation used to indicate a mistake or error. It is often spoken aloud but can also be written or typed. There is no specific origin or usage for the term whoops in Urban Dictionary or other online sources. It is a common expression used in everyday conversation to acknowledge and laugh off a mistake. Here are some examples of how to use the term whoops:

  1. “Eww, what is that picture of? Whoops, I meant to send that to someone else!”
  2. “I accidentally spilled coffee on my shirt. Whoops!”
  3. “I tripped and dropped my phone. Whoops, I hope it’s not broken!”
  4. “I forgot to bring my umbrella and it started raining. Whoops, bad timing!”
  5. “I accidentally deleted an important email. Whoops, I’ll have to ask for it again.”

Slangs similar to Whoops

Oops, my bad, oopsie, blunder, slip-up, and fumble are all similar to “whoops” because they are all expressions used to acknowledge and laugh off a mistake or error. These terms are used in everyday conversation to indicate a mishap or blunder.

Is Whoops A Bad Word?

No, “whoops” is not a bad word or vulgar word. It is simply an exclamation used to express a mistake or error. It is commonly used in everyday language and does not carry any negative connotations.
